Publication number: 20240158405Abstract: Bifunctional compounds, which find utility as modulators of non-receptor Leucine-rich repeat kinase 2 (LRRK2), are described herein. In particular, the bifunctional compounds of the present disclosure contain on one end a moiety that binds to the cereblon E3 ubiquitin ligase and on the other end a moiety which binds LRRK2, such that the target protein is placed in proximity to the ubiquitin ligase to effect degradation (and inhibition) of target protein. The bifunctional compounds of the present disclosure exhibit a broad range of pharmacological activities associated with degradation/inhibition of target protein. Diseases or disorders that result from aberrant regulation of the target protein are treated or prevented with compounds and compositions of the present disclosure.Type: ApplicationFiled: November 16, 2023Publication date: May 16, 2024Inventors: Erika Marina Vieira Araujo, Michael Berlin, Steven M. Publication number: 20240157619Abstract: The disclosure belongs to the technical field of heat insulation materials, and discloses an in-situ microfibrillated reinforced polymer composite heat insulation foam material as well as a preparation method and application thereof. This disclosure adopts a polypropylene matrix, a fiber-forming polymer, an elastomer and an antioxidant as a foam material. The foaming material is subjected to a primary melt blending process and a hot stretching process first, then subjected to a secondary melt blending process and cooling granulation and subjected to a pressing process, and a composite board is obtained. The composite board is subjected to supercritical fluid foaming process, and a composite heat insulation foam material is obtained.Type: ApplicationFiled: October 23, 2023Publication date: May 16, 2024Applicant: Zhengzhou UniversityInventors: Jing Jiang, Lian Yang, Junwei Sun, Min Qiao, Caiyi Jia, Xiaofeng Wang, Qian Li

Publication number: 20240158844Abstract: A dual-probe method for fluorescence quantitative PCR (Polymerase Chain Reaction) is disclosed. The method involves the use of a Taqman dual-probe detection system with the same pair of primers. The dual probes includes a detection probe and a reference probe. The detection probe targets the wild-type sequence at the hotspot mutation site, which can cover multiple adjacent mutations. The reference probe targets the wild-type sequence adjacent to the target sequence. Both probes share the same pair of upstream and downstream primers. This method uses a single reaction qPCR (quantitative PCR) method, which can simultaneously detect multiple adjacent mutations. It effectively saves tissue samples and greatly shortens the testing period. Moreover, the close proximity of the target and reference sequences enhances the reliability and accuracy of the results, making it widely applicable in various fields.Type: ApplicationFiled: March 6, 2023Publication date: May 16, 2024Inventors: Yiwei HUANG, Chun MENG, Jing HONG, Wenxiao MA, Xiaoya WANG, Qixin LIN

Patent number: 11982608Abstract: Disclosed is a method for measuring surface energy of aggregates based on static drop method, comprising (1) aggregates grinding and pretreatment; (2) obtaining the surface texture index; (3) calculating the surface energy based on static drop method experiment; (4) fitting to obtain a functional relationship between the surface texture index and surface energy; (5) calculating the surface energy of the original aggregate. The method considers the influence of the grinding process on the surface texture of the aggregates when measuring the surface energy of the aggregates, which significantly improves the accuracy of the static drop method test. The static drop method can be used to replace the vapor adsorption method to test the surface energy of aggregate, and the low-cost optical contact angle instrument can replace the expensive magnetic suspension weight balance system to test the surface energy of aggregate, which greatly reduces the test cost.Type: GrantFiled: May 27, 2022Date of Patent: May 14, 2024Assignee: WUHAN UNIVERSITY OF TECHNOLOGYInventors: Rong Luo, Jing Luo, Chongzhi Tu, Tingting Huang, Xiang Wang, Longchang Niu, Qiang Miao
